What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Toronto to Boise?

The average price of all fl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
If you are looking for a flight deal from Toronto to Boise, look for departures on Tuesdays and avoid leaving on a Friday, as it's usually the priciest day. When flying back from Boise, Saturday is the cheapest day to fly and Sunday is the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ise is March, where tickets cost $386 on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are January and December, where the average cost of tickets is $1,023 and $721 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price on the fl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Boise, you should book around 1 week before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 58 days before departure.

Which airlines provide the cheapest flights from Toronto to Boise?

The cheapest price for the route for each airline clicked by KAYAK users in the last 72 hours.
The best deals for a one-way ticket found by KAYAK users over the last 3 days were on Delta ($219) and WestJet ($263). The cheapest round-trip tickets were found on Delta ($367) and American Airlines ($407).

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Toronto to Boise?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Boise with an airline and back to Toronto with another airline. Booking your flights between Toronto and BOI can sometimes prove cheaper using this method.

  • What is KAYAK's "flexible dates" feature and why should I care when looking for a flight from Toronto to Boise?

    Sometimes travel dates aren't set in stone. If your preferred travel dates have some wiggle room, flexible dates will show you all the options when flying to Boise from Toronto up to 3 days before/after your preferred dates. You can then pick the flights that suit you best.
